Georgia Meyers Obituary

Georgia L. Meyers, 83, of Montrose, Iowa, passed away on Tuesday, June 22, 2021, at Montrose Health Center, Montrose, Iowa.

Georgia was born on January 11, 1938, the daughter of George and Emma (Sapp) Rossi.

Georgia was a member of Montrose Church of the Nazarene and loved listening to southern gospel music. She enjoyed being a homemaker and farm wife and loved crocheting and giving those items away to others. Georgia also loved John Wayne and Shirley Temple movies and working on puzzles in her spare time.

Georgia is survived by her two sons: Gene (Michelle) Meyers of Fort Madison, Iowa and Michael Root; grandchildren Amy Troge and Elizabeth Meyers; great-grandchildren Wyatt Troge and Jason Troge; two sisters Marge Crabtree of Pharr, Texas and Emma Jean Johnson of Davis City, Iowa; brother Tommy Rossi of Georgia; and many nieces, nephews and cousins.

Georgia was preceded in death by her parents; siblings Robert Stoops, Billy Stoops, Helen Nye, Viola McCroy and George Rossi; and granddaughter Jennifer Meyers.

Georgia’s life will be celebrated with a funeral service at 11 am on Friday, June 25, 2021, at Montrose Church of the Nazarene with a visitation from 9:30 am to 11 am directly before the service. Burial will follow at Montrose Cemetery.

Memorials may be directed to Montrose Church of the Nazarene.
